944 T ABS self test failure
Hi Guys
I have an on going problem with my 1990 Porsche 944 Turbo ABS system.
I am selling the car and would like to fix the problem before it goes to a new owner.
ABS sets up correctly on start up –
I move forward and it fails the self test at 4 mph.
I have rigged a switch to the fuse and can turn the ABS on or off.
I turn it off – accelerated hard and switch it back on – ABS sets up beautifully.
It will not reset at anything but hard acceleration.
Until the next time I stop where it fails the next self test when starting off.
It sounds like a bad earth problem which is overcome when I accelerate hard.
Checked and re cleaned every earth I could find
Perhaps it is caused by one of the two relays on the ABS pump?
I booked it into the Porsche dealer a couple of years ago and they said that it was the right rear ABS cable, so I ordered one but the ABS failed immediately on start up.
Funny thing was when I collected the car it setup beautifully and only failed again when I was a mile or two away.
Hoping someone has a clue.
